iBall has launched another 3G enabled tablet the iBall Slide 7271 HD70 that is slim & attractive for a price tag of Rs. 8,999. This dual SIM tablet with dual standby mode supports both 2G as well as the 3G networks with full phone functionality.

The iBall Slide 3G 7271 HD70 is using the cortex A7 dual core processor clocked at 1.3GHz (Chipset unknown). The capacitive multi touch screen is of size 7 inches supporting resolution of 1024 x 600 pixels.

This dual SIM tab runs on Android Jelly Bean 4.2 with 1GB RAM and 8GB storage. Of the 8GB storage 2GB is allocated for apps and about 4GB as phone storage. There is a Micro SD card slot that supports 32GB external cards.

When it comes to the cameras there is a front facing VGA camera with video calling support and another 2MP camera placed on the rear with single LED flash. Additional features are Wi-Fi (b/g/n), Bluetooth, micro USB port, GPS with A-GPS, 3G (7.2Mbps) and 2G (GPRS/EDGE).

The 7271 HD70 comes with a not so impressive battery capacity of 3000 mAh. With 3G support, the tablets should have over 4000 mAh battery for better battery backups. iBall Slide 7271 HD70 an upgraded version of iBall Slide 7271 3G is now available for Rs. 8,999.
